    For E-Bay you often have to PM the seller and ask whether they post to here, bearing in my the shipping won't be cheap so hopefully your item is!

    Amazon is easy, just with DVD's bear in mind the 'region #' or hopefully you have a multi-region DVD player.
    If it is household items (coffee machine etc) they won't ship to Oman...there are certain categories that do and don't so look into it before you buy.

    Other thing to consider is setting up an Aramex mailbox in either the UK or US (one-off fee), which effectively means you can take advantage of any of the 'free shipping' situations on various websites, then you just pay for the shipping to Oman.

    10KG's cost you ONLY 40?!?!? It should have been 69.5

    Aramex shop n ship is not meant to be used for heavy packages. You'll obviously get burned. It is meant for smaller 1-2KG max packages. They've increased their rates recently which makes it kinda annoying, but still beats prices here.

    BE careful when buying from eBay or Amazon, IF the Item arrives Dead you are pretty much stuck with it. AS mostly eBay users don't ship overseas and even if they do and back it up with warranty, it will cost you a lot to send it back, and AGAIN pay for shop and Ship or Shipping directly to Oman. Same is with Amazon.

    PayPal works from Oman for sending money only Neo.
    You cannot receive money with PayPal with a Omani Credit Card or Bank Account (had an experience when someone wanted to Pay me and tried PayPal)
